Production and Delivery

I discovered that having the written proposal expedites the process of picking out what visual aids I
wanted in the presentation. Have it written out plays like a script in my head and I can remember
everything that I wanted to be in the presentation. This also gives me a better view when I don’t like
the way the script is playing out on paper. I can reread my plan and see if a new “movie” plays in my
head. Adjustments aren’t as scary.

Reviewing and editing

I used to use many various kinds of fonts colors and schemes. I know realize that in the past when the
presentation has more visuals and a consistent design I learned more from the presenter. During one
of my recent classes one of my biggest gripes was that the teachers or TA’s slides were nothing but
words. If I wanted that I could have just kept reading the book. I didn’t realize that this was all apart
of CRAP. In my presentation I did focus more on consistency. I also am concentrating on the saying it
and then saying it again skill. Repetition in life is everything.
